符號:``
用法:
1、引用字符串,換行不需要加號連接。
2、引入字符串,${變量名},前後不需要加號連接。
ES6 開發報錯 object null is not iterable (cannot read property Symbol(Symbol.iterator j這樣的錯又時很難發現是怎麼回事,遇到這樣的錯,要考慮ES6語法中
說明: 我們在項目中書寫的ES6代碼,由於考慮到低版本瀏覽器的兼容性問題,需要把ES6代碼轉換成低版本瀏覽器能夠識別的ES5代碼。使用 babel-loader 和 @babel/core 來進行ES6和ES5之間的鏈接,使用 @babe
1.變量聲明let && const let用於聲明變量,const用於聲明常量,兩者都爲塊級作用域。 const聲明的常量被設置完成之後就不能修改,如果聲明的是一個對象,那麼可以改變對象的值,只要內存地址不變即可。 let聲明的變量不存
你可能正在使用的特性 ES6除了新增特性外還有兩類特殊的特性:其中一些特性早已被各大廠商廣泛實現並使用,但是它們並沒有被標準化;還有一些特性採自過去其它的標準。 定型數組(Typed arrays)、數組緩衝(ArrayBuffer)和
一、Map的基本用法 JavaScript對象本質上是鍵值對的集合,但是傳統上只能用字符串當作鍵,在使用上會有很大的限制。 ES6提供了Map數據結構,類似於對象,也是鍵值對的集合,但是鍵不止能用字符串,各種類型的值都可以當作鍵,
引子 今天在學習DOM的時候,做一個修改元素的案例,想要做個簡單的獲取時間的網頁,發現在格式化輸出時es6版本的JS已經刪除了format()函數,沒辦法,只能自己手寫一個。 實現代碼 // 補零函數 functi
關於JS中自定義錯誤類型的一些建議 在開發前端項目,調試過程中,經常能看到一些拋出異常的錯誤提示。這些錯誤提示的拋出,意味着代碼運行的中止。 爲什麼我們需要自定義自己的錯誤類型呢 很多做前端可能很少會接觸自定義錯誤類型,貌似挺高深
關於export 、export default 的常用方法 一個js文件中,最多隻能有一個export default,可以同時有多個export 看一下下面的例子 1、只有一個export時,應使用export default
ES6總結系列之 變量的解構賦值 篇 變量的解構賦值:分解一個對象的結構,對變量進行賦值,前提:等號兩邊的模式相同 數組的解構賦值 可從數組中提取值,按照對應位置,對變量賦值 let [a,b,c] = [1,2,3]; //a
深入瞭解模板字符串 這次將給大家帶來模板字符串用法和幾大注意要點 用法 模板字符串由一對反引號標識符組成,${}爲取值表達式 let name = "Tony"; let age = 18 ; name+"今年"+age+"歲"
reduce array.reduce(function(total, currentValue, currentIndex, arr), initialValue) total 必需。初始值, 或者計算結束後的返回值。
原因:JavaScript 中對象的賦值是默認引用賦值的(兩個對象指向相同的內存地址) 解決辦法 this.edit = Object.assign({}, info, { ParkID: 1, ParkName: “aaa” }
本篇文章參考以下博文 Array.prototype.filter() array.filter()妙用 文章目錄一、定義二、語法三、實例3.1 過濾數組中的假值3.2 數組中不同的部分3.3 數組去重四、轉化爲 ES5 之後
本篇文章參考以下博文 ES6,Array.from()函數的用法 JavaScript from() 方法 Array.from() Array.from()五個超好用的用途 文章目錄一、前言二、定義三、語法四、實例4.1 結
本篇文章參考以下博文 數組裏面對象去重的3種方法 數組方法reduce JavaScript 高性能數組去重 JavaScript數組去重(12種方法,史上最全) 文章目錄前言測試模板一、數組去重性能測試1.1 Array.f